Publisher Description: The poems in 365 Nights will leave your skin bumpy and your body shivering. From teenage love stories, to the stories written on death beds, there is a poem here for you. Each night explores different perspectives of life, wrenching out emotions that many of us have never experienced. 365 Nights allows you to walk in the steps of strangers Exploring controversial themes such as arranged marriages, rebellion, systematic killing of female infants, and genocide, 365 Nights leaves no rock unturned. With each sunset and every moon rise, the poems come to life, playing a show for you with vivid colours and intricate details. 365 Nights will leave you with dreams that will last the day until you return back, to the night. |
